An announcement to my fellow MESA pilots,
I’m not sure if anyone read the MOU that was signed last month by the MEC Chairmen, but it reduced our guarantee based on the flying. Probably not news to most, but one interesting detail not mentioned is that you will still only get 11 days off still while flying for reduced guarantee. Effectively flying for less pay. This was not sent out to the pilot group for approval and signed in less than 24 hours without consensus from the pilot group.
Crew scheduling now sends out a message effectively saying the quantity of reserve Pilots are now being stepped up. This post is just to inform the pilot group of what is being done without their consent.
